M3-5K Table Low Speed Centrifuge: Max RPM: 5500rpm: Max RCF: 4900*g: … WebThe relationship between RPM and RCF is as follows: g = (1.118 × 10-5) x R x S². Where g is the relative centrifugal force, R is the radius of the rotor in centimeters, and S is the speed of the centrifuge in revolutions per minute.

WebMar 2, 2015 · The centrifugation speed was not critically influential on the activity of cell extract for CFPS. We observed that speeds over 10,000 RCF (4°C for 10 min) for the first centrifugation provided no significant difference in activity among extract samples (Figure 3C), noting that these speeds were sufficient to remove all un-lysed cells (see below).
